May 22, 2021 · Broadly speaking, you have two types of self-publishing platform available: Retailers. Aggregators. Retailers are stores such as Amazon that allow people to browse and buy books. Aggregators are specialist services that allow authors to distribute their books to a large number of retailers through a single service.

ACX is Audible’s audiobook self-publishing platform. So in this way, just as CreateSpace is Amazon’s print self-publishing platform and KDP is Amazon’s digital self-publishing platform, ACX is Amazon’s audiobook self-publishing platform. Print in both paperback and hardcover. Earn up to a 60% royalty on print book sales. We print your paperback and hardcover books on demand so you don't have to pay any upfront costs or carry any inventory. We deduct the cost to print your book from your royalty rate when we ship an order. Aug 22, 2019 · Self-publishing on Kobo does not require any exclusivity to their site. If you publish with them, you can publish elsewhere. You do not have to pay any fees to publish on Kobo. Sep 7, 2021 · The self-published magazines helped shape the feminist movement, and in the 1980s, the punk scene saw an array of zines dedicated to music and a cultural revolt against authority. In the 1990s , the riot grrrl movement (an underground feminist punk movement) used zines to reach out to women across …
